Towel Bear

Christmas is coming sooner than you think. It will sneak up on us before we are ready.

Do you need a quick gift Idea that is really cheap, useful, easy to make and you can create it in less than 3 minutes? Then keep reading.

I'm going to share with you this really cute Idea I found online. Nope this one is not my own. I just do not have anything else to write about today so I'm gonna share this cute little "Towel Bear" I made.



You will need:
1- Hand towel. (I got mine at Walmart for .98 cent).
3- Hair ties. ( you can use rubber bands but the hair ties can be re-used on hair).
1- Ribbon.

Click HERE for a video showing you how to fold the towel and make this adorable little teddy bear.

 

 

Just add a lotion, soap, hand sanitizer, gift card, candy, etc to the bear and you will have a useful gift in a spur of the moment that they are sure to love.

These would make great gifts for teachers, employees, neighbors, secret pals, friends or even homeless shelters. They would also be great gifts for your college students.

Everything in this craft can be put to use. The best thing about it is, it requires NO sewing or glue.
You do not even have to be crafty. You just need to know how to tie a bow.

Mountain Fires

There have been eighty major wild fires burning across the Southeast. Eighteen of those fires are in the North Carolina Mountains. Those mountains have been burning since October 23rd. 

 
"Lake Lure"

The winds have been up and we have not had rain in about thirty-five days now. According to the weather view, there are no chances of rain at least for another week. 

 

Its dry, its windy.

We now have a "no burn" ban going on all around the area. Though I live aproximatly a hundred miles from these mountains, we are almost smothered by the smell while the smoke is filling the air. Its hazy and smoggy. The air quality in my area is at Orange. 

I pray we get some rain soon, especially in the mountains of North Carolina.
